    Bloomberg Terminal added Ethereum

    In the Bloomberg Terminal computer system used by professional financial market participants, debt instruments will appear on the Ethereum blockchain. It is reported by CoinDesk .

    The tool will be provided by Cadence, which will thus become the first supplier of financial instruments on the blockchain to receive a global financial instrument identifier (FIGI).

    Each FIGI record contains data on interest rate, repayment schedule, and instrument type. In the case of Cadence, it also includes the address of the Ethereum smart contract.

    “We create an immutable register that stores performance data at the asset level at all stages of their life cycle … This can help predict the obtained data on asset performance, and each counterparty in a private credit operation can refer to the exact price, structure and investments”, – Saved CEO Cadence Nelson Chu.

    It should be noted that the company has already released eight instruments with a maturity of one, three and nine months, as well as an automatic renewal function. All of them will be available at Bloomberg Terminal.

    Recall that last year the Huobi exchange index was added to the Bloomberg Terminal system , and the Bloomberg Galaxy Crypto Index was launched to track the market capitalization of the ten most liquid cryptocurrencies, including Bitcoin, Ethereum, Monero, Ripple, ZCash, Bitcoin Cash, EOS, Litecoin , Dash and Ethereum Classic.
